A Plumber Can Evaluate the Supply Lines


A supply line, especially a dish washer port, links the dishwasher to a water source. If you buy a brand-new supply line, a plumber can make sure that the line is compatible with both your dish washer as well as water source. If you determine to use an existing supply line, a specialist plumber can inspect it to make sure that it's in good condition as well as does not have any kind of leakages.

An Improper Installation Can Void the Dish washer's Service warranty


Prior to mounting a dishwasher on your own, you need to check out the warranty carefully. Even somewhat harming the dishwasher during the setup process can nullify the service warranty. Since the cost of a dishwashing machine varies in between $300 to $1,000 as well as upwards, that can be an expensive error. Even if the dishwashing machine still functions, you will not be able to replace it should it break quickly. So, unless you come in handy and also have experience setting up dishwashing machines, you should work with a plumber so you do not risk your warranty.

Installing a Dishwasher Calls For a Selection of Devices


If you do not have a selection of tools on hand, you may need to make a trip to Lowe's or Residence Depot. To install a dishwashing machine, you need the following devices: pliers, an adjustable wrench, a set of screwdrivers, a tube cutter, and opening saws.

Not Installing Your Dishwasher Appropriately Can Result In a Hill of Issues


Not just can installing a dishwasher correctly invalidate your service warranty, yet it can also produce a mess. For example, if you do not install the supply line appropriately, you might take care of leaks-- or even worse, a flood. You may additionally experience a "water hammer"-- when the water runs too rapidly with your pipes as well as triggers loud drinking audios. Last but not least, if you incorrectly mount your dishwasher to the waste disposal unit, you might notice pungent scents or have deposit on your dishes.

PLUMBING SERVICES YOU'LL NEED FOR A KITCHEN REMODEL


SINK AND DISHWASHER INSTALLATION


If you want to relocate the sink and dishwasher, major plumbing work needs to be done. The sink needs an access point to both hot and cold water, which connects from the faucets and a waste-pipe. Your dishwasher calls for the same type of plumbing work. The water supply and waste-pipe access are extended from the sink to the dishwasher, which is why these two appliances need to be placed next to each other.


If you're simply looking to have a new sink installed in the same location, less professional work needs to be done, meaning your bill will be significantly cheaper. When shopping for a new sink, consider upgrading to features like extensions, sprayers, soap dispensers and a stainless steel garbage disposal.
